Understanding Ventilator Basics

What is Ventilator Support?

Ventilator assistance refers to the mechanical support supplied to clients who are incapable to take a breath appropriately on their own. This support can be life-saving and is important in taking care of conditions like intense respiratory distress disorder (ARDS), chronic obstructive lung disease (COPD), and pneumonia.

Types of Ventilation Techniques

Invasive vs. Non-invasive Ventilation

Invasive air flow entails inserting an endotracheal tube right into a client's airway, while non-invasive air flow utilizes masks or nasal prongs. Understanding these distinctions aids healthcare providers select the suitable method based on person needs.

Modes of Mechanical Ventilation

Mechanical ventilators can operate in different settings, consisting of:

image

    Assist-Control (AIR CONDITIONER): The machine gives breaths at a set price but enables clients to launch added breaths. Synchronized Periodic Obligatory Ventilation (SIMV): The equipment offers a mix of obligatory breaths and enables spontaneous breathing. Pressure Support Air flow (PSV): The ventilator helps each breath started by the individual up to a fixed pressure level.

Knowing when to use each mode is essential for effective ventilation management.

Ventilator Stress Assistance Explained

One vital concept in innovative strategies is recognizing ventilator stress assistance-- the pressure aid offered during spontaneous breaths. It's vital for decreasing the job of breathing while guaranteeing adequate oxygenation.

Monitoring People on Mechanical Ventilation

Key Criteria in Person Monitoring

Monitoring individuals on mechanical air flow entails assessing a number of specifications:

Oxygen saturation levels End-tidal carbon dioxide (ETCO2) Respiratory rate Tidal volume delivered

Continuous surveillance enables quick treatment if complications arise.
